Cinema Mirror is an active optic set to be
installed in false ceilings hiding the
projection equipment, and that through
a pulsation it opens a floodgate of
335x335 mm., allowing the projection of
the image, thanks to its two mirrors,
without causing the trapeze effect on the
image. For that, Cinema Mirror and the
screen must be in the same plane or with
a difference from 0 to 12 cm. (Fig. 1).
Always be sure to perpendicularly set the
projected light with the projection screen,
any difference may negatively affect the
image (Fig. 2).

GENERAL RULES
The equipment should be installed by
installers specialized in public locations.Install
and protect the line in accordance with the
low-tension electrical technical regulations,
as well as the MIE-BET-025 complementary
technical instructions, “Installations in
locations of public concurrence”. The
equipment should be connected to ground
protection.
All the required electric works of this
equipment should be carried out by
electricians, qualified electronics or
competent people according to the electrical
technical regulations of each country.
The alimentation requires an automatic
bipolar switch with MINIMUM 3 mm
separation between contacts.
Flammable materials must not be
placed within a radius of 1 meter of
the equipment (see instruction manual
of video projector to be installed).
Secure and protect the alimentation cables
and hoses, gear, material, etc. in such a way
that they are not near: moving parts or heat
sources.
The equipment must be installed in the
ceiling at a distance so that it is not within
arms reach of a person. Secured above the
site itself or on a metallic bracket strong
enough to hold the weight of the equipment
plus the image projector.
The equipment operation is: for interior use
in a false ceilings.
The operating position is horizontal with the
hatch facing downward.
The equipment will not be accessible during
operation, before accessing the means of
connection or the inside of the equipment,
all electrical alimentation circuits of the
equipment must be disconnected.
In the event of any questions, contact the
Technical Service or your distributor.
SAFETY
The equipment should be examined every
90 days, the structure fasteners, movable
parts,mechanical cables,electrical parts,etc.
should be checked and lubricated if
necessary.
Do not install this unit in an unstable place.
Do not alter neither modify this unit.
Do not use this unit in a bathroom neither
near liquids or inflammable gases.
Do not connect the unit to an electric tension
different from the one specified.
Do not force the storm door in their opening
or closing journey, since the mechanics of
the motor could be seriously damaged.

INSTALLATION
PROCEDURE
Cinema Mirror has been built with the
knowledge of technical ceiling features.For
this reason,it has leveling supports (see Fig.
3 Detail 9) that adapt to the“T”ceiling profiles
and allow you to install it without the use of
tools.
If the ceiling is made of plaster, wood,glass,
etc. and it does not have profiles, adapt a
HC 635 model ceiling frame kit. An
aluminium profile designed to adapt ceilings
to Cinema Mirror and give access to the
interior of the ceiling (see accessory page).
Order it from your distributor.
BEFORE PROCEEDING TO INSTALL
The area where Cinema Mirror will be
installed,next to the projection equipment,
will support an extra weight. Reinforce the
perimeter next to the installation area (Fig.
4) with the accessories recommended by
the manufacturer.
CHOOSE THE PLACE OF THE
INSTALLATION
The projectors do not have the same focus
distance.If you do not know the optic data
of the projector ready to be installed proceed
as follows.
Place the projector on a table. Connect the
electric current to the projector and switch
on the projection equipment. Leave it for a
few minutes so that the projector reaches
its maximum brightness.
Keeping the zoom control in the maximum
opening, bring the equipment closer to, or
move it further away from the test wall that
you have chosen until obtaining the desired
screen - image width. In this case, measure
the distance between the lens and the image.
Put the zoom in the minimum opening,and
move the projector away until obtaining the
same screen width than the obtained in the
previous paragraph, and measure the
distance between the lens and the image.
Calculate the focal distance with the
following formula:
The average optic centre determines the
distance and the place to install the projector
and in consequence Cinema Mirror.
You can get bigger precision if you deduct
20 cm of the journey from the projector lens
to the active lens.

INSTALLATION
Remove the 6 screws that secure the table
to the Cinema Mirror chassis.
Secure the variable position table, with its
screws,in the best place so that the projector
rests on its support feet.
Place the projector on the variable position
table horizontally centred relative to the
passive mirror.This will be its working place.
ADJUSTMENT OF THE PASSIVE
MIRROR
To centre in height the passive mirror, (Fig.3
detail 6),in relation to the lens of the projector,
remove the screws that hold it to the chassis
and move them up and down so that the
centre of the mirror stays at the centre of the
lens of the projector.Tighten firmly, but not
to strong,the axis of the mirror to the holes
of the chassis, to make possible an ulterior
adjustment of the axis.
Place the graded plate supplied with the
equipment on the Cinema Mirror profile
(Fig.6).
The passive mirror should be placed to 37º
in relation to the base of the projector.Please
turn the passive mirror up so that the angles
between the mirror and the template
coincide in parallel.Fasten strongly the screws
of the axis of the passive mirror.
UNPACKAGING AND PROCESS OF
ASEMBLY
Open the box of the Cinema Mirror and take
out the protection butt plates.
Take out the plastic covers.
Take out the rubber of protection of the
floodgate of the active mirror.
Place a fabric table cloth on a board, table,
bench, etc. to protect and take care of the
paintwork on the equipment gate.Separate
the bevel from the gate and leave it ready
to be installed later in the ceiling finish.Leave
Cinema Mirror on the table cloth.
Projectors do not always have the optic
in the same place; it can be to the left,
centred, or to the right.
For this reason, Cinema Mirror is equipped
with a tray called variable position table
(Fig.5).
The variable position table has 5 positions:
1centred, 2moved to the left, 3moved to
the right, 4turned 180º and centred, and 5
turned180º and to the right.

ATTENTION.
If the whole image is not represented on the
projection screen,this may be due to the fact
that:
•The projector zoom is closed.
•The projector is very near the passive mirror.
•The active mirror is excessively closed.
Correct these differences.
The image may not be parallel with the
projection screen base due to height
differences between the place of installation
of the screen and that of the projector (Fig.
7A).
In the connecting rods that move the active
mirror, (Fig 3 detail 8) there is a connecting
rod-active mirror regulation screw that
corrects the defect.If you want to lift the image,
move the connecting rod screw of the place
affected upwards. (Fig.7B)
Remember the adjustment elements that you
have to obtain a cinema image.
1.- Projector zoom and focus.
2. - Vertically adjustable feet,in the projector.
3. - Trapeze correction, manual, automatic or
electronic,in the projector.
4.- Passive mirror turn.
5.- Active mirror movement
6.- Horizontal image control in the connecting
rods.
7. - Left / right movement of the projection
screen (only some makers)
8.- Regulation of the height extension of the
projection screen.

MAINTENANCE
The mechanics and mobile parts of the
equipment don't specify of a severe
maintenance, but if it is convenient the
application of a lubricant in the mobile parts,
with a minimum periodicity of 90 days.
Revise the electric installation and its
connections, likewise revise the anchorage
from the unit to the roof.
The optic lenses will clean with non abrasive
cloths, using neuter soaps or simply with
common water.

TECHNICAL SPECIFICATIONS
TECHNICAL FEATURES HC37.53
Supply: Mod.E 230 VAC / 50Hz.
Mod.US 115 VAC / 60Hz.
Power: 10 W
Starter (push-button not included): Instantaneous / 1 A to 230 VAC
Noise level: < 15 dB
False ceiling minimum height: From 170 mm to 217 mm
Maximum height of floodgate slope: 265 mm
Mirror opening time: 30”
Motor reducer: 500/1
Minimum dimension of the hole to embed: 335 mm x 335 mm
